Which term describes difficulty focusing or making decisions?

Explanation:
This item is about identifying a term that matches trouble with attention. When someone has trouble focusing, the clinical way to describe that specific difficulty is a diminished ability to concentrate. It directly pinpoints the struggle to sustain attention on tasks. Impaired judgment refers to problems with evaluating options and making safe decisions, which is a different cognitive issue. Elevated attention and rapid thinking describe the opposite of difficulty in focusing. So the term that best fits the described difficulty is diminished ability to concentrate.
